Information facilities are the Web’s again administrative center. They’re the invisible engines that persistent the whole thing we do on-line. 8 million of them run complete tilt 24/7 to fulfill our insatiable, world call for. Those are large complexes coated with row after row of servers, and far of the power those farms use is going towards cooling those processing machines.
To mood all that further warmth, corporations construct them in chillier areas – in international locations like Iceland, Eire, Finland, and Canada. Even so, they use greater than 200 terawatt hours a 12 months international, the identical of Australia’s annual electrical energy intake. For a rustic like Eire, that implies devoting one-third of all nationwide electrical energy to data-center operations by way of 2027.
The advanced global’s irreversible and apparently insatiable streaming urge for food method those numbers are nonetheless monitoring upward. If truth be told, world records switch and the infrastructure had to strengthen it has surpassed the aerospace industry (2.five% of world totals) on the subject of carbon emissions (just about four% of world totals). Which begs the query: What occurs as growing international locations start catching up?
Consistent with analysis by way of Huawei’s Anders Andrae, records facilities are on the right track to constitute eight% of world electrical energy call for by way of 2030 – a staggering percentage if the research proves true. Heavy emissions, mild strikes towards sustainability
Firms that run records facilities are trending in opposition to tapping renewables to reduce their environmental affect. Google lately introduced a string of wind and solar energy offers. In the meantime, Amazon pledged to measure its emissions and run utterly on renewables by way of 2030. Fb, for its phase, hopes to succeed in the similar purpose inside of a 12 months. Microsoft has mentioned it objectives to be carbon adverse by way of 2030.
However sadly, there’s these days simplest such a lot inexperienced electrical energy to head round. Except records facilities get started construction their very own renewable provide. And whilst the potency good points are important, they represent a rearguard fight in opposition to our expanding call for.
Visitors to and from records facilities is rising exponentially, surpassing 1000000000000 gigabytes in 2017, and environment friendly new applied sciences are simply going to permit us to stay streaming extra records. As an example, 5G networking is also extra environment friendly than what it’s changing, however it is going to virtually unquestionably allow applied sciences that can use monumental quantities of information. The information streamed by way of an self reliant automotive, for example, would utterly fill a median computer’s 240GB onerous force in not up to a minute.

Consistent with Cisco, 60% of the arena’s inhabitants shall be on-line, with video making up greater than 80% of all web visitors, by way of 2022. A contemporary learn about from Digital Leisure Design and Analysis discovered that the emissions created by way of gaming within the U.S. is more or less identical to introducing 5 million further automobiles at the highway. The environmental implications span each and every form of streaming and on-line job – and the affect is fast.
There are steps folks can take these days to make a distinction within the close to long run as we pace towards 2030, a 12 months singled out by way of the United Countries as a world time limit for local weather motion. Consistent with Harvard Regulation College’s resident power supervisor, turning down the display brightness on gadgets used for streaming from 100% to 70% can cut back general power intake by way of 20%. On-line avid gamers and those who move different types of leisure from their gadgets, just like the Roku TV or an iPhone, must believe turning off techniques utterly when no longer in use. Individuals who plan to rewatch the content material they move must believe downloading or discovering different ways to transport the content material offline right through viewing studies.
Firms construction applied sciences, streaming content material, and turning in hardware to shoppers wish to be held in charge of taking steps to cut back – or, on the very least, offset – the environmental harm their services and products inflict. There are steps they are able to take that received’t cost a fortune or hinder innovation. As an example, YouTube may just cut back its annual carbon footprint by way of the identical of about 300,000 metric lots of carbon dioxide if it simplest despatched sound to customers who’re actively looking at programming (as opposed to having a internet tab or dormant cell utility open). And extra corporations may just signal directly to industry-wide projects just like the UN’s Taking part in for the Planet pledge that objectives to chop “gaming-related carbon emissions by way of a minimum of 30 million lots by way of 2030.”
